رمزنگاری نامتقارن در همه چیز از گواهینامههای SSL و TLS گرفته تا تراشههای کارت اعتباری و امضای اسناد دیجیتال استفاده میشود. امنیت بیش از هر زمان دیگری حیاتیتر است و یکی از مهمترین مهارتهایی است که امروزه در صنعت وجود دارد.
آنچه خواهید آموخت:
امنیت دادهها و ارتباطات مسائلی حیاتی هستند. در تمام صنایع در این دوره آموزشی، ایمنسازی دادهها با رمزنگاری نامتقارن، دانش پایهای رمزنگاری جفت کلید خصوصی عمومی را یاد خواهید گرفت و توانایی به کارگیری عملی آن را در پروژههای خود به دست خواهید آورد. ابتدا، خواهید آموخت که جفت کلیدها چیست، چگونه آنها را تولید کنید و چگونه آنها را ذخیره کنید. در مرحله بعد، گواهینامههای X.509 را با جزئیات کشف خواهید کرد. در نهایت، نحوه پیادهسازی یک PKI کاملاً کاربردی از جمله یک مرجع گواهی را بررسی خواهید کرد. پس از اتمام این دوره، مهارتها و دانش رمزنگاری نامتقارن مورد نیاز برای به کارگیری امنیت در پروژههای خود را خواهید داشت.
نمونه ویدیوی آموزشی ( زیرنویسها جدا از ویدیو است و میتوانید آنرا نمایش ندهید ) :
[ENGLISH]
01 Course Overview [1min]
01-01 Course Overview [1mins]
02 Introducing the Public Key Infrastructure [18mins]
02-01 The Public Key Infrastructure [1mins]
02-02 PKI Trust and Responsibilities [3mins]
02-03 Certificate Authorities Overview [1mins]
02-04 The Root CA [3mins]
02-05 The Intermediate CA [2mins]
02-06 The Policy CA [3mins]
02-07 Using Public and Private Keys [2mins]
02-08 Getting a Certificate Signed by a CA [1mins]
02-09 Revoking a Certificate [2mins]
03 The Public Private Key Pair [14mins]
03-01 Overview [0mins]
03-02 The Key Pair [5mins]
03-03 The Math of Key Pairs [7mins]
03-04 Storing Keys [2mins]
03-05 Summary [0mins]
04 X.509 Certificates [13mins]
04-01 Overview [1mins]
04-02 Certificate Types [2mins]
04-03 The Certificate Structure [3mins]
04-04 The Certificate Signature Request Structure [1mins]
04-05 The Certificate Revocation List Structure [1mins]
04-06 Certificate Chains [1mins]
04-07 Certificate Identities [2mins]
04-08 Certificate Extensions [2mins]
05 Writing the Code [53mins]
05-01 Overview [1mins]
05-02 Fight 657 [1mins]
05-03 The Trust Us Certificate Authority [2mins]
05-04 The Project [2mins]
05-05 Data Transfer Objects [3mins]
05-06 The Data [1mins]
05-07 Initializing the CA [2mins]
05-08 Creating a Cryptlib Key Pair [6mins]
05-09 Creating Certfificates [3mins]
05-10 Creating the Root CA Certificate [3mins]
05-11 The Policy and Intermediate CAs [4mins]
05-12 The CA Database [2mins]
05-13 Submit a Certificate Signing Request to the CA [1mins]
05-14 Issuing a Certificate [3mins]
05-15 The Duck Airlines Project [2mins]
05-16 Creating a Bouncy Castle Key Pair [3mins]
05-17 Encryption [3mins]
05-18 Decryption [2mins]
05-19 Signing Data [2mins]
05-20 Validating Signatures [1mins]
05-21 Running the PKI Project [5mins]
05-22 Summary [1mins]
06 Summary [1min]
06-01 Summary [1mins]
[فارسی]
01 نمای کلی دوره [1 دقیقه]
01-01 بررسی اجمالی دوره [1 دقیقه]
02 معرفی زیرساخت کلید عمومی [18 دقیقه]
02-01 زیرساخت کلید عمومی [1 دقیقه]
02-02 اعتماد و مسئولیتهای PKI [3 دقیقه]
02-03 بررسی اجمالی مقامات صدور گواهی [1 دقیقه]
02-04 The Root CA [3 دقیقه]
02-05 CA متوسط [2 دقیقه]
02-06 خط مشی CA [3 دقیقه]
02-07 استفاده از کلیدهای عمومی و خصوصی [2 دقیقه]
02-08 دریافت گواهی امضا شده توسط CA [1 دقیقه]
02-09 لغو گواهی [2 دقیقه]
03 جفت کلید عمومی خصوصی [14 دقیقه]
03-01 نمای کلی [0 دقیقه]
03-02 جفت کلید [5 دقیقه]
03-03 ریاضی جفت کلید [7 دقیقه]
03-04 ذخیره کلیدها [2 دقیقه]
03-05 خلاصه [0 دقیقه]
04 گواهینامههای X.509 [13 دقیقه]
04-01 نمای کلی [1 دقیقه]
04-02 انواع گواهی [2 دقیقه]
04-03 ساختار گواهی [3 دقیقه]
04-04 ساختار درخواست امضای گواهی [1 دقیقه]
04-05 ساختار فهرست ابطال گواهی [1 دقیقه]
04-06 زنجیرهای گواهی [1 دقیقه]
04-07 هویت گواهی [2 دقیقه]
04-08 برنامههای افزودنی گواهی [2 دقیقه]
05 نوشتن کد [53 دقیقه]
05-01 نمای کلی [1 دقیقه]
05-02 مبارزه 657 [1 دقیقه]
05-03 مرجع صدور گواهی اعتماد به ما [2 دقیقه]
05-04 پروژه [2 دقیقه]
05-05 اشیاء انتقال داده [3 دقیقه]
05-06 دادهها [1 دقیقه]
05-07 راه اندازی CA [2 دقیقه]
05-08 ایجاد یک جفت کلید Cryptlib [6 دقیقه]
05-09 ایجاد گواهینامهها [3 دقیقه]
05-10 ایجاد گواهی CA ریشه [3 دقیقه]
05-11 خطمشی و CAهای متوسط [4 دقیقه]
05-12 پایگاه داده CA [2 دقیقه]
05-13 ارسال یک درخواست امضای گواهی به CA [1 دقیقه]
05-14 صدور گواهینامه [3 دقیقه]
05-15 پروژه خطوط هوایی داک [2 دقیقه]
05-16 ایجاد یک جفت کلید قلعه فنری [3 دقیقه]
05-17 رمزگذاری [3 دقیقه]
05-18 رمزگشایی [2 دقیقه]
05-19 امضای داده [2 دقیقه]
05-20 اعتبارسنجی امضاها [1 دقیقه]
05-21 اجرای پروژه PKI [5 دقیقه]
05-22 خلاصه [1 دقیقه]
06 خلاصه [1 دقیقه]
06-01 خلاصه [1 دقیقه]
ادوارد در سال 1995 با مدرک لیسانس در علوم کامپیوتر از دانشگاه دیتون فارغ التحصیل شد و اغلب آرزو میکند که برای بازگشت به آن زمان اسرار فیزیک کوانتومی را بشکند. بعداً اد با وزارت امنیت داخلی قرارداد بست تا بخشی از تیمی باشد که یک سیستم ضد تروریسم را قبل از انتقال به بخش ضداطلاعات افبیآی، جایی که با واحد مفاهیم پیشرفته ساخت راهحلهای نرمافزاری برای رسیدگی به مشکلاتی که این اداره با آن مواجه بود، کار کرد، باشد. . او تصمیم گرفت به منطقه کلیولند برگردد تا نزدیک خانواده باشد زیرا دخترش 3 ساله شد و در One Call Now به عنوان مدیر توسعه نرمافزار مشغول به کار شد. هنگامی که One Call Now خریداری شد، او به عنوان معمار سازمانی به تیم معماری در بیمه بین ایالتی ملی پیوست. آقای Curren دارای 3 حق ثبت اختراع برای نوآوریهای نرمافزاری است، گاه به گاه یک مدرس مدعو در دانشگاه آکرون است و دوست دارد اشتیاق خود به فناوری را با علاقه خود به پرواز پیوند بزند.